On Saturday, US President-elect Donald Trump appointed Kashyap 'Kash' Patel as the next Director of the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I).
Trump announced Patel's nomination on the social media platform Truth Social, highlighting his distinguished career in various government roles. These roles encompass Chief of Staff at the Department of Defense, Deputy Director of National Intelligence, and Senior Director for Counterterrorism at the National Security Council during Trump's initial presidential term.
Trump praised Patel for his work investigating the so-called 'Russia, Russia, Russia Hoax,' calling him an 'America First' supporter who has spent his career exposing corruption, ensuring justice, and protecting the American people.

Trump tasked Patel with addressing pressing issues such as rising crime rates, criminal gangs, and human and drug trafficking at the US border. He highlighted that Patel would work under Attorney General Pam Bondi to restore the FBI's core values of Fidelity, Bravery, and Integrity.
Trump announced that the FBI will put an end to the increasing crime wave in America, break up migrant criminal gangs, and halt the dangerous spread of human and drug trafficking at the border. He stated that Kash will collaborate with the esteemed Attorney General, Pam Bondi, to bring back Fidelity, Bravery, and Integrity to the FBI.
Donald Trump secured a second term as President of the United States by winning the 2024 presidential election with 295 electoral votes, defeating Democratic candidate Kamala Harris, who garnered 226 votes.
Following his victory, Trump has been rapidly assembling his foreign policy and national security team in preparation for his inauguration in January 2025.
